Common Bifold Door Problems That Require Repair
Bifold doors, while typically robust, are consisted of many moving parts that can be susceptible to wear and tear. Understanding the common concerns is the first step towards recognizing when repair is needed. Here are some frequent issues house owners encounter:
Sticking or Jamming: This is possibly the most typical complaint. Doors might stick when opening or closing, requiring excessive force. This can be triggered by numerous factors, including:
Misaligned Tracks: Tracks can become bent, deformed, or obstructed with debris, preventing smooth roller motion.Damaged Rollers or Hinges: Rollers that are worn, broken, or poorly lubricated can trigger friction and sticking. Likewise, stiff or damaged hinges can impede folding action.Settling Foundation/Frame Shift: Building settlement can trigger the door frame to shift a little, resulting in binding and sticking.
Squeaking or Grinding Noises: Unpleasant noises during operation frequently show friction in between moving parts. This could be due to:
Lack of Lubrication: Rollers, hinges, and tracks require routine lubrication to ensure smooth, peaceful operation.Worn Rollers or Hinges: Metal-on-metal contact from used elements can produce squeaking or grinding noises.
Doors Not Folding Properly: Bifold doors should fold neatly and efficiently. If they are having a hard time to fold correctly, or bunching up unevenly, it might be due to:
Damaged or Loose Hinges: Loose or broken hinges can prevent the doors from folding in a straight line.Incorrect Roller Alignment: If rollers are not appropriately lined up within the track, the doors may not fold efficiently.
Gaps and Drafts: Bifold doors are developed to offer a weather-tight seal. Spaces appearing around the doors can lead to drafts, energy loss, and even water leaks. This may be triggered by:
Warped Door Panels: Wood doors can warp due to moisture or temperature fluctuations, creating gaps.Harmed Weather Stripping: Weather removing around the door frame degrades in time and requires replacement to maintain a correct seal.Misaligned Doors: If the doors are no longer aligned correctly within the frame, spaces can appear.
Damage to Door Panels: Accidental impacts or basic wear and tear can trigger damage to the door panels themselves, consisting of:
Cracks or Dents: Physical damage can impact the structural stability and appearance of the doors.Rotting Wood (for Wooden Doors): Exposure to wetness can result in rot in wooden bifold doors, needing panel repair or replacement.Harmed Glass Panes (for Glazed Doors): Cracks or breaks in glass panels require immediate attention for security and security.

Preventative Maintenance to Extend the Life of Your Bifold Doors
Regular upkeep can substantially extend the lifespan of your bifold doors and avoid lots of typical issues. Here are some necessary maintenance pointers:
Regular Cleaning: Clean tracks and door panels frequently to eliminate dust, particles, and grime. Use a soft brush or vacuum cleaner for tracks and a mild soap and water solution for door panels.Lubrication: Lubricate rollers, hinges, and tracks periodically (at least two times a year) with a silicone-based lubricant. This will keep moving parts operating smoothly and quietly.Examine and Tighten Hardware: Regularly check screws, hinges, manages, and rollers for looseness. Tighten up any loose hardware to prevent instability.Check Weather Stripping: Inspect weather condition stripping for damage or deterioration. Replace harmed weather condition removing without delay to maintain a weather-tight seal.Address Minor Issues Promptly: Don't neglect little problems like sticking or squeaking. Resolving small issues early can avoid them from escalating into major repairs.Expert Servicing (Optional): Consider setting up an annual professional service check-up for your bifold doors. A service technician can perform extensive assessments, lubrication, adjustments, and identify prospective concerns before they end up being major issues.

Q: How frequently should I oil my bifold door rollers and tracks?A: It's suggested to oil bifold door rollers and tracks a minimum of two times a year, or more regularly if you discover them becoming stiff or loud.
Q: Can I replace bifold door rollers myself?A: Yes, replacing bifold door rollers is a DIY task for those with fundamental handyman abilities. However, ensure you acquire the proper replacement rollers for your door type and follow correct installation procedures. If you are not sure, it's best to call an expert.
Q: What type of lubricant is best for bifold doors?A: Silicone-based lubricants are generally recommended for bifold door rollers, hinges, and tracks as they work in lowering friction and do not draw in dust and particles as much as oil-based lubricants.
Q: Why are my bifold doors sticking even after lubrication?A: If lubrication doesn't solve sticking concerns, it could be due to misaligned tracks, harmed rollers, or frame concerns. These issues generally require expert evaluation and repair.
